PIGINTHEPEN and I went out at 8 this morning and were off the water by 1230 with our double limit (well not technically, couldnt get our last 2 unders). The fish are really starting to stack up. Water was 60.6. White body chartruse tail. Fished anywhere from 3 foot of water to 13 foot of water. Caught fish everywhere. Get on our there, fishies are bitin!

I was also out that day but had trouble finding the big ones, ended up cleaning 11 with on real pig that went just shy of 14 inch. he came in about 2 ftw. lots and lots of little ones. Spent most of my time fairly close to bow-woods fishing main lake laydowns with red-chartruse or black-chartruse.
